Handover note — Crumbwheel order cutoffs.

Welcome aboard. The bakery cutoff rule in Crumbwheel closes same-day orders at 14:00 local to each storefront, not UTC — this has bitten us twice. Holiday overrides live in the calendar service and take precedence silently, so always check there first when a cutoff looks wrong. To unlock the calendar service's admin console after a restart, enter the recovery passphrase below.

vault phrase of bagap-bahaf = silion-pelox-sorox-casdor-quenwyn-fraax-eliox-praael-kelion-quenvan-kasox-rusael-norius-belvan

Hey — handing off the waveform preview in Chirpdeck before I rotate to the Larkmoor team. The renderer downsamples to 400 peaks per clip and caches them in the blob store; regeneration only triggers on re-upload. Known wart: stereo files over 90 minutes get a blank strip because the peak job times out. Tarn knows the history. Full notes, including the timeout workaround, live on the internal page here.

operations page: https://jenkins.zemvarcloud.local/job/merge_requests/repo/build/73930b4b30f0a8ed

## Rebalance planner v2 for SpokeShift

Hey! This PR swaps our greedy dock-rebalancing heuristic for a weighted flow solver in SpokeShift's planner. Security-wise: no new external calls, and the truck-routing input is now schema-validated before parsing, so the old injection vector through station names is closed. Heads up that defaults changed. The tuning constants we settled on are below.

tuning table, yajog-yahof:
BUDGETS = {
    "lamvan": 303,
    "wenox": 460,
    "fenvan": 525,
}